Any Gyros? mmmmm Lamb!!!!
Not lamb, but there is a serious gyro place on the autopista a mile or so south of Plaza Jacaranda. I think it's called Parada Aleman. AZB did a photo essay on the place a while back. It's where we always stop for a gyros on the way back from the capital. It's owned by 2 Turkish and German guys, and had a German bakery/sweet shop.

Really, really, really good...
